The San Jose Sharks signed 33-year-old forward Jeff Skinner to a one-year deal valued at $3 million. Skinner, who scored 29 points with the Edmonton Oilers last season, has a career total of 699 points in 1,078 NHL games. Although Skinner primarily played on the third line last season, he previously had a strong performance with the Sabres, scoring more than a point per game. His offensive metrics show he creates chances effectively, while he struggles defensively. Overall, he has maintained a positive offensive impact despite defensive drawbacks.
